Harry Hudson leads the Edison Bell studio band (under the name "Harry Hudson's Melody Men") in a nice laid-back version of "What'll You Do?", with good solos by Sid Phillips on alto sax and a nice Venuti-Lang style violin and guitar duet by, presumably, George Melachrino and Bill Herbert…..I can't imagine that the violin in this duet is played by Mantovani!

This side had a huge amount of hum on it, which I managed to largely get rid of without affecting the music, but a little bit remains that I couldn't remove.

HARRY HUDSON'S MELODY MEN
Harry Hudson, directing: Murray Dempsey and Arthur Niblo - trumpets / Ben Oakley - trombone / Sid Phillips - alto sax, baritone sax / Ken Warner - alto sax / George Melachrino - tenor sax, violin / Annunzio Mantovani - violin / Jean Paques - piano / Bill Herbert - guitar / Bill Busby - brass bass / Wag Abbey - drums

Recorded in London, c. January 27, 1928

11439-1…….What'll You Do?…….Edison Bell Winner 4802
